  Right where we left off! Three guards gritted their teeth with rage as they held their blades next to Izika's throat. Sweat dampened Izika's boots as black drops started to roll down his arms like sweat.

'Murder?! That scream from before must have been from someone who had discovered the body. Calm down and focus, if I try to do anything I might end up killed.'

  The air was spread thin thanks to the tension as the murmurs from the servants acted as the background music of a suspense scene. The guards took note of Izika's hesitation and stood their ground. In a world where people have supernatural abilities, a cornered human becomes more lethal. What felt like an eternity was merely a few seconds until the sound of a pair of boots was heard.

"What's all the commotion about? Everyone apart from the guards, you may leave us to handle this."

A dark blonde-haired woman stepped out of the crowd, instructing the servants and other spectators to leave the scene. Wearing a white dress shirt tucked into black jeans and a large pouch strapped to a walnut brown belt matching her boots, this woman meant business.

  "So, what happened here? Seems like you're taking out your anger onto a child," the woman asked, crossing her arms.

  One of the guards straightened his posture. "Mrs Susten Chéng, we found a suspect near the scene. They ran off to the storage houses until we managed to catch them."

  Susten sighed. "Alright... bring him in for questioning."

The guards sheathed their swords as one of them let iron come out of their hands and wrap around Izika, encasing the rest of his body apart from his head and neck. Susten turned and headed for the main building, the guards following suit as the iron encased Izika hovered off the ground and followed them. Axel and the servants who were told to disperse watched as the five walked off to the main building.

*VRRRM*

Axel heard his phone vibrate and grabbed it from his pocket, answering the call. "Hello?"

"Axel. For you to answer the call so calmly, that must mean that the delivery was a success, right?"

Axel paused for a few seconds until he gulped down the feelings that choked his throat. "Yes, sir."

"Alright then, the others will handle the rest."

  With that, the mysterious call cut as Axel remained hearing the dead line ring in silence.

  Meanwhile, in the main building, Susten and the guards took Izika down many hallways with Izika himself encased as the iron followed the guards. Izika kept his head down as they took him, not wanting to show that he had some confidence.

'Alright, think. Someone murdered Lady Zeita, and the murder took place inside the palace, exact location unknown. Suspects? The person who bumped into me at the truck. If the guards' eyes were dead set on the test tube, then that might mean that the person who bumped into me must have been the real suspect. Best not jump to conclusions though...'
